## Ownership

The Sievegate bloom filter sits in front of the Kestrel key-value store to suppress reads for absent keys. Its false-positive rate, sizing parameters, and rebuild cadence are documented in `docs/sizing.md`; changes to any of these require a design note. Questions, incident escalations, and approval for parameter changes go to the maintainer named below.

account owner for kafop-haweg: Pelax Gilael Istir

### Audit item 14 — Wavecrest audio preview

Check that the waveform preview renders from the downsampled peaks file, never the raw audio — generating peaks on the fly was the cause of the big memory spike last quarter. Confirm the cache eviction job still runs nightly and that previews for deleted tracks get purged within 24 hours. If peaks look flat or clipped, rerun the extractor with the default gain. Ownership for this whole preview pipeline rests with the person named below.

named custodian: Brivan Eliath Quenox Frador

Test-plan note for the sync: Wavetrace's waveform preview must render within 300ms for clips under five minutes, with peak data downsampled server-side. We'll verify zoom accuracy at three levels and confirm stale cache invalidation after re-uploads. The preview-generation endpoint in staging expects the bearer token below.

bearer token for tawig-bahif: eyJhbGciOiJIUzI1NiIsInR5cCI6IkpXVCJ9.eyJzdWIiOiIo-yiO33jvEIn0.T9qLInSAqhTN

Ticket: FIELD-2281 — Expired credentials blocking offline sync

For the weekly sync: the Heronpath field-survey app's offline mode stopped reconciling on Monday because the cached sync token expired while crews were out of coverage. Surveys queued locally are intact, but uploads fail silently until re-auth. We've extended token lifetime to 30 days and reissued credentials. The replacement key for the internal sync service follows.

service key, fafog-fahaf: vxb3-x55